THE STATISTIC-AL ANALYSIS OF IDENTIFICATION IN 134 CASES OF EYE INJURIES

Abstract: The statistical analysis of identification in 134 cases of eye injuries is reported in this article. In this series of eye injuries, 112cases are male, 22cases are female. Age is 8 to 65, most of them are 20-40years(61.9%). Most of injurants are fist and foot(57.5%) .40 cases are serious injury .94 cases are slight injury. The author has discusced the cause of that left eye injury is more than right eye and double eye injury, relationship between injurant and site of injury, degree of best identification time. Effective method of examining simulation blindness and principle deciding the best time of identification are put forward.
